The August 6, 2024 hail swath map for Wheeling, WV covers approximately 502 square miles and includes an estimated 169,737 people inside the mapped footprint. The largest mapped area is in the < 0.50" hail band, covering 303 square miles. The highest estimated population exposure is in the < 0.50" hail band with 110,102 people.
| Mapped Hail Band | Impact Area | Population |
|---|---|---|
| < 0.50" | 303 sq mi | 110,102 |
| 0.50-0.75" | 159 sq mi | 46,336 |
| 0.75-1.00" | 32 sq mi | 10,826 |
| 1.00-1.25" | 8 sq mi | 2,473 |

Public storm report tables connected to the August 6, 2024 hail map for Wheeling, WV currently list 2 public hail reports, 22 public wind reports, and 0 tornado reports.
| Date & Time | Hail Size | City | State | Description |
|---|---|---|---|---|
August 6, 2024 1:55 PM CT |
1.00 in | Tarentum | PA | No National Weather Service description provided. |
August 6, 2024 1:56 PM CT |
1.00 in | Brackenridge | PA | Observed at 9th Ave and Prospect St |
| Date & Time | Wind Speed | City | State | Description |
|---|---|---|---|---|
August 6, 2024 1:30 PM CT | 1 W Homeacre-Lyndora | PA | Large limbs broken. Reported via mPING | |
August 6, 2024 1:30 PM CT | 1 W Meridian | PA | Large limbs down | |
August 6, 2024 1:46 PM CT | 1 NE Great Belt | PA | Late report: Number of trees down on Greatbelt Road. | |
August 6, 2024 1:47 PM CT | 2 SW Russellton | PA | Limbs down in Camp Deer Creek | |
August 6, 2024 1:53 PM CT | 5 N Sarver | PA | Two-foot diameter tree down from thunderstorm wind | |
August 6, 2024 1:54 PM CT | Arnold | PA | Trees and wires down in Arnold. Time estimated via radar. | |
August 6, 2024 1:55 PM CT | Aliquippa | PA | Several trees snapped. 4 trees uprooted | |
August 6, 2024 2:10 PM CT | 1 NNE Mccandless Townsh | PA | Tree down along Kummer Road near Hilltop Drive. Time estimated via radar. | |
August 6, 2024 3:59 PM CT | 1 WNW North Canton | OH | Roof damage to communications center with windows and doors also blown out. | |
August 6, 2024 4:06 PM CT | 1 E Perry Heights | OH | Report from mPING: Trees uprooted or snapped;. | |
August 6, 2024 4:06 PM CT | 3 SE Perry Heights | OH | Report from mPING: 3-inch tree limbs broken; Power poles broken. | |
August 6, 2024 5:07 PM CT | Beaver | PA | Trees down | |
August 6, 2024 5:20 PM CT | New Brighton | PA | Trees down | |
August 6, 2024 5:20 PM CT | 8 ENE Zelienople | PA | Tree and wires down | |
August 6, 2024 5:30 PM CT | 8 ENE Zelienople | PA | Tree and wires down | |
August 6, 2024 5:45 PM CT | Weirton | WV | Numerous trees down | |
August 6, 2024 5:45 PM CT | 3 N Weirton | WV | Numerous trees down | |
August 6, 2024 6:10 PM CT | 1 SW Bridgeville | PA | Large limbs snapped by wind. | |
August 6, 2024 6:25 PM CT | Gastonville | PA | Trees down | |
August 6, 2024 6:27 PM CT | 1 SSE Irwin | PA | Roof of a home collapsed. Time estimated via radar. | |
August 6, 2024 6:35 PM CT | West Newton | PA | Tree down on N 3rd St | |
August 6, 2024 6:37 PM CT | 1 SE Knoxville | PA | Tree down across Rt 166. |
